1. Yunmeng Mountain National Forest Park
Yunmeng Mountain National Forest Park covers a total area of 2208 hectares, with the main peak at an altitude of 1414 meters. The park has abundant landscape resources, dense forests, and a hundred flowers covering the mountains. The air is fresh, the water is sweet, and it has very suitable climate and altitude conditions. According to measurements, the temperature in Yunmeng Mountain is generally 6-7 ℃ lower than that in the plain area below, and the air humidity and ventilation conditions are superior. However, the summer temperature in Yunmeng Mountain remains between 20-24 ℃, with the highest temperature reaching around 28 ℃
Yunmeng Mountain is a famous mountain in the suburbs of Beijing with mountain scenery characteristics. It is a unique Zhongshan landform forest park in the Beijing area. It is known for its four wonders: many strange pines and rocks, many ancient caves in Xianshan, many waterfalls and springs, and many auspicious trees, Yao grass<21Difficulty index: ★★★
Six major landscape features: peculiar peaks, rocks, waterfalls, smoke clouds, forests, and historical sites. They not only form a spatial picture of dynamic and static changes, but also give people an aesthetic enjoyment of visual and auditory senses, making them feel refreshed and amazed, and reluctant to leave

2. Shangfangshan Forest Park
Shangfangshan Forest Park is located in Hancunhe Town, Fangshan District, 70 kilometers away from the city center. The scenic area has nine major caves represented by Yunshui Cave and 72 temples represented by Douli. Elderly people aged 60-70 (with ID card or senior citizen card) are eligible for a 50% discount Bus route: Beijing tourists can take the 980 express train from Dongzhimen Station to Miyun, then transfer to Miyun 52 bus to reach the north gate of the scenic area The Yunxiu Valley Hunting Natural Scenic Area in Miyun, Beijing is located at the foot of Wuling Mountain in the northeast of Miyun County. It is adjacent to Wuling Mountain National Forest Park to the east, Simatai Great Wall to the west, and only 1.6 kilometers away from Wuling West Peak High Mountain Water Skiing Scenic Area. It is the best central location for one to three day tours. The scenic area is 132 kilometers away from the city center of Beijing. It is a unique multi-functional tourist area in Beijing that integrates shooting, hunting, vacation, entertainment, and scientific research. It has unique natural and cultural landscapes. The highest altitude of the scenic area is 1700 meters, with a vegetation coverage rate of 95%. The average temperature in summer is 21 degrees. There are numerous strange peaks, rocks, caves, canyons, streams, waterfalls, forests, flowers, and wild flora and fauna; The Great Wall, ancient castles, thatched cottages, artificial lakes and other cultural landscape resources are abundant; Entering Yunxiu Valley, one can see the continuous flow of blue water throughout the year, with over 20 ponds and waterfalls arranged in an orderly manner, and more than 40 scenic spots for a leisurely stroll.
